是的啊。变量指向的对象老是变,不是什么好的编程习惯。
不过很多语言比如 c++ 没弄明白 const reference 和 immutable object 两个概念的区别。这是编程语言的锅。
【 在 DoorWay 的大作中提到: 】
: 函数开始,还没干事,先声明十个八个变量,也挺烦。
: 更烦的事是有人一直给指针改内容,或者一个错误代码变量一直复用
: 好比一下给我介绍7个人,张三李四王五…,开始讲他们的故事,过了一会儿,好,现在给他们换换名字,我继续讲哈
: ...................
--
修改:hgoldfish FROM 124.72.111.*
FROM 124.72.111.*